Hospital appointments
Why can’t the newly built Louisa Jordan hospital be used for routine clinic appointments that have been put on hold for months. Especially patients that have been referred by their GP to see heart and cancer specialists. My gp made a referral to cardiology for me in January as I had chest pains and racing heart rate. Been given statins since then but really need an ECG. Feels like I’m waiting on a full blown heart attack at any minute and the stress from waiting is only adding to the problem. Who knows how long I will have to wait to see someone now, hopefully before a heart attack
Why the contribution is important
If people don’t get seen quickly then what other damage is being done while they wait. Do I have to have a heart attack to see a cardiologist? Don’t believe that every cardiologist and oncologist are working on the covid wards. Open the Louisa Jordan hospital for consultations for all the clinic appointments while it is infection free with staff and patients using the appropriate PPE
